New Years Drive Challenge 2020
New Years Drive Challenge
For a number of years I have had a personal New Year resolution or challenge to take my military vehicles out for a drive on New Years Eve or more exactly early New Years Day. Some years it happens a little later, but the goal is to start my MV driving year off early and right, so I extend the invitation to join in and share your drive. Just to explain no military vehicles are exposed to the road salt, of our winter climate in New Hampshire, the drive is restricted to local dirt road. Who in the MLU community be the first to drive their MV in 2020? Cheers Phil PS As it stands now only two of the three CMPs will be ready to drive. The HUP (aka BEAST) and the Pat 13 C60S (aka BEAUTY) are up and running. For some strange, or as yet unknown reason, the 1941 Pat 12 C60L which ran fine all fall and refused to start a weeks ago. I even got it an early Christmas present of a new battery yesterday but so far no joy.
